Flashed this ROM a few days ago, good for the most part, but I'm having problems with my APN and IMEI.

When I first flashed the ROM, with the EXT4 format option after a stock reset and cache wipe, my cell reception would occasionally completely cut. I found the problem to be something wrong with my APN's; there were none and I couldn't add any, so I formatted and flashed again. That solved the initial APN problem, but now I have a new one. When I first turn on my phone and the signal bounces around from H+ and 3G, it's fine. But once it hits 4G LTE it for some reason loses my IMEI (Becomes 0's) and I can no longer send texts, until I make a call. After I make a call it seems to reset my IMEI and everything goes back to normal.

Is this a known issue?

For starters, Samsung and the carriers have all sorts of checks on the back end to see if you're rooted, running a custom ROM, or have made any modifications to /system. Often times Android devs (us included at times) will do a mod and as soon as it works, they run with it. But there are numerous instances in which stuff is broken behind the scenes and you don't even know it. This build includes some serious patches on the back end which make things run properly and phone home correctly without raising red flags to Samsung or your carrier. TrevE has a post here with more info (http://xdaforums.com/showpost.php?p=38444474&postcount=17932). Point is: You can trust Synergy to be clean, secure, and free of any behind-the-scenes nonsense.

Now to answer the questions I know you're already gonna ask: Ink effect is now sorta fixed (all colors work, including the 'none' option, but the color flash still happens. We took a long look at this one and it's still evading us at the moment. The math they use in the ink effect is weird...

Glance view: We have (and actually have had for the last several builds now) the framework working to support this. In fact we were able to kick it off with adb commands at our will, but hovering your hand over the sensor didn't quite work and it's actually gonna be a nasty hack to get fully working. We're still looking at it, but no promises on when or if we fully get it working.

Also, The reason we asked about your CPU revisions earlier in the thread is because some of you guys are running different revs and they handle voltages differently. Bad news for you guys on rev 4: You can't adjust your voltages. Samsung hard-coded them right into the CPU. You can try to change them all you want, but they aren't going to stick. You're probably stuck with stock. We've added scripting to AROMA which will tell you your CPU revision you have and if you can't adjust voltages, we'll tell you right there in AROMA so pay attention.

    Q&A

    Q: How do I install this ROM?
    A: Download the ROM from the "Download Links" section above, place the file on your phone's external SD card, and then flash via your recovery.

    Q: How can I enable mass storage mode?
    A:
    Code:
    To enable mass storage mode:
    1) Plug your phone into the computer via USB and MTP will likely open as it usually does
    2) Open a command prompt
    3) Type: adb shell mountsd

    At this point the phone's external sd card will open up in mass storage mode (so you can use it just like a usb drive). Be advised that mass storage and MTP cannot mount the SD card at the same time so MTP will show the SD card with folders empty and something like -1330850028 bytes of storage - don't panic, this is normal since, again, it can only be mounted one place at a time.​

    Code:
    To get back to MTP:
    1) While still plugged in via USB
    2) Open a command prompt
    3) Type: adb shell unmountsd

    Q: Why can't I "adb remount"?
    A: This is a symptom of the locked down kernel. We've created a workaround for now.
    Code:
    To set /system as R/W, in a terminal or command prompt type:
    adb shell
    su
    sysrw
    Code:
    To set /system back to R/O, in a terminal or command prompt type:
    adb shell
    su
    sysro

    Q: How do I lower the WiFi transmit power?
    A: Do the following
    Code:
    We've added iwconfig. This lets you set wifi transmit power. Download "wifi tx power" from play store or run the following commands:
    
    adb shell iwconfig wlan0 txpower X
    X == txpower(in dBm). 32/25/18/11/4
    
    To make sure it set run :
    adb shell iwconfig
    
    and look at TX-Power (3rd row down)

    Q: What other tools does this ROM have
    A:
    • Native Wireshark app support
    • RUN THESE FROM INSIDE ADB SHELL:
    • Latencytop - For latency monitoring
    • htop - A system monitor
    • Powertop - Run with screen off to show number of wakes per second (helpful for finding rogue processes, batt drain, SODs, etc)
    • We also added the following text editors:
    • vim
    • nano
